Output dc65d85346b13c3b62987ed4ce8a75bbcfd8046f126385f0d8423dda7a0e493e:2

value
343108
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85950382f2689f5f3f36b8d4a09d950a809dbf5c OP_EQUAL
address
3DsLJiEc66dJtUyXQwGWoekosNaV2bGnWg
transaction
dc65d85346b13c3b62987ed4ce8a75bbcfd8046f126385f0d8423dda7a0e493e
confirmations
158068
spent
true